The US, South Korea, and Japan will conduct a joint military exercise from September 7 to 11 to enhance readiness against North Korean threats. The annual Freedom Edge exercise will take place in international waters near Jeju Island, focusing on air defense, submarine warfare, and cybersecurity. This initiative aims to strengthen cooperation and ensure stability in the Pacific region. The announcement follows recent joint maneuvers between US and South Korean forces, which were shortened by President Trump. He seeks to arrange a new summit with North Korean leader Kim Jong Un.
